Shadow Toolbox (1st release)
Shadow is a Matlab toolbox written to detect the GNSS satellite in the shadow of the earth and remove them from the RINEX observation file. The main toolbox performs the following tasks: 1- Reads Rinex observation file 2- Reads precise ephemeris file (SP3) 3- Detect the satellite in the shadow...
